SVV_EXTERNAL_TABLES
Verwenden Sie SVV_EXTERNAL_TABLES zur Anzeige von Details für externe Tabellen. Weitere Informationen unter CREATE EXTERNAL SCHEMA. Verwenden Sie SVV_EXTERNAL_TABLES auch für datenbankübergreifende Abfragen, um Metadaten zu allen Tabellen in nicht verbundenen Datenbanken anzuzeigen, auf die Benutzer Zugriff haben.
SVV_EXTERNAL_TABLES ist für alle Benutzer sichtbar. Superuser können alle Zeilen anzeigen, während normale Benutzer nur die Metadaten anzeigen können, auf die sie Zugriff haben.
Tabellenspalten
Spaltenname | Datentyp | Beschreibung |
---|---|---|
schemaname | Text | Der Name des externen Amazon-Redshift-Schemas für die externe Tabelle. |
tablename | Text | Der Name der externen Tabelle. |
tabletype | Text | Der Typ der Tabelle. Einige Werte sind TABLE, VIEW, MATERIALIZED VIEW oder enthalten " ", eine leere Zeichenfolge, die keine Information darstellt. |
location | Text | Der Speicherort der Tabelle. |
input_format | Text | Das Eingabeformat |
output_format | Text | Das Ausgabeformat. |
serialization_lib | Text | Die Serialisierungsbibliothek. |
serde_parameters | Text | SerDe-Parameter. |
compressed | integer | Ein Wert, der angibt, ob die Tabelle komprimiert ist; 1 gibt an, dass sie komprimiert ist, 0 , dass sie nicht komprimiert ist. |
parameters | Text | Tabelleneigenschaften. |
Beispiel
Das folgende Beispiel zeigt Details zu svv_external_tables mit einem Prädikat für das externe Schema, das von einer Verbundabfrage verwendet wird.
select schemaname, tablename from svv_external_tables where schemaname = 'apg_tpch'; schemaname | tablename ------------+----------- apg_tpch | customer apg_tpch | lineitem apg_tpch | nation apg_tpch | orders apg_tpch | part apg_tpch | partsupp apg_tpch | region apg_tpch | supplier (8 rows)